Handover Note — Logistics Provider Change

For heads of department: we are mid-switch from Bexley Carriage to Norvath Freight. Contracts signed; cutover in six weeks. Warehouse scheduling at the Ellmere depot moves first. Watch invoice duplication during overlap. Escalations go to the incoming director from Monday. The confidential rationale and forward plan appear directly below.

management briefing: The pricing group signed off on a budget of $378.8 million for Project Kasael.

## Configuration

Quick heads-up for review: we're chasing feature parity between the Marblekit JS SDK and the new Marblekit Go SDK, so both now read from the same .env layout. Most keys are self-explanatory — PARITY_MODE toggles the shared test matrix, and SDK_TARGET picks which client the harness exercises. One thing to double-check: both SDKs need the shared gateway credential, and it belongs on the very next line of the env file.

vault entry, yahif-yajep: COURIER_KEY29=b802bdf8034096b65a51c6ba5abe2

## Deployment

The Tidewren pipeline runs static analysis on every build and compares results against a checked-in baseline file. The baseline suppresses known legacy findings so new code is held to a stricter standard. Never regenerate the baseline as part of a routine deploy; that silently absorbs new findings. If a deliberate refresh is needed, bump the baseline version and note it in the changelog. The analyzer's current settings are as follows.

service settings:
PRAWYN_PIN=9848
PRAWYN_METRICS_HOST=metrics.prawyn.lumicworks.corp
PRAWYN_LOG_LEVEL=warn
PRAWYN_TENANT=pelius